Salzburg Cathedral
A significant landmark in Salzburg's Old Town, this cathedral is known for its stunning baroque architecture.
Getreidegasse
A bustling shopping street in the heart of Salzburg's Old Town, famous for its charming narrow passages and Mozart's Birthplace.
Mozart's Birthplace
Located on the famous Getreidegasse, this is the house where the renowned composer Wolfgang Amadeus Mozart was born.
Hohensalzburg Fortress
A historic and imposing fortress perched on a hill, offering breathtaking panoramic views of Salzburg and its surroundings.
Mirabell Palace and Gardens
A beautiful palace and its meticulously manicured gardens, offering a picturesque setting for leisurely strolls and a glimpse into baroque splendor.
Hellbrunn Palace
Known for its unique and playful 'trick fountains' that drench unsuspecting visitors, this palace offers a fun and interactive experience.
